(10/15-10/15) Luzhou Soup Noodles and Traditional Art Carnival

Objectives

Luzhou Soup Noodles and Traditional Art Carnival centers on the local delicacy- "soup noodles" and is composed of many local cultural elements. The local government hopes to achieve the following goals via this activity:

1. Participation by the local people: The participation of temples, art groups and local culture workers aims to demonstrate the charms of Luzhou culture. In addition to provide healthy leisure activities, the local government also hopes that local people will better understand the local characteristics, religious culture as well as recognize the local area through the divine generals parade and relics visiting.

2. Making a life full of art: Photography and painting contests are organized to magnify the local features. The winning pieces will be exhibited with the local historic artifacts in the district art center, providing more chances for people in the community to attend art and culture activities and creating a quality cultural environment.

3. Sustainable Culture Development : Local historic relics, religious centers, art exhibitions and traditional delicacy- soup noodles are combined in marketing the local features of Luzhou to improve the cultural cultivation and living standard of people in the community.

Introduction

Since 2007, in response to the local cultural festival of one township one feature, Luzhou Township Office has planned meticulously for "Luzhou Soup Noodles Carnival" centering on soup noodles and combining with local well-known historic relics, religious centers, and art exhibitions to improve the local people's recognition toward the local area as well elevation of cultural demeanor. In addition, the opening of Luzhou MRT has further attracted people from all over Taiwan to come and explore Luzhou's many faces. Meanwhile, it has become a new choice for holiday trips, which helps booming the local tertiary industry and marketing the "Beauty of Louzhou".

About the Activity

1. Soup Noodles Tasting: Well-known soup noodle stores are invited to Luzhou to hold two "1000 Bowls of Free Soup Noodles" activities. 1500 free soup noodles are offered to the public for them to taste the good flavors of their hometown in each activity.

2. Painting & Photography Contest: Centering on soup noodles, historic sites, tourist attractions, faces of divine generals, a photography contest (no requirements for participants) and a painting competition participated only by students of local junior high schools and elementary schools are organized for civilians to better understand the local culture,to encourage them to explore the local features, and to demonstrate the beauty of Luzhou through lens and painting brushes.

3. Exhibitions: To hold Louzhou History Special Exhibition is in the local art center with the participation of local artists, schools and culture workers that provide the materials and artworks by the local historic people. Winning pieces of photography and paintings of local features are also displayed. It is to encourage citizens to attend various art exhibitions as well as cultivate their art appreciation abilities. Furthermore, Invitations of students field trips to the local art center are issued by the Government so that seeds of culture will be rooted.

4. Parents and Children DIY Activity and the fun games.

Local Highlights

In the first year of Tongzhi Emperor (1862) in Qing Dynasty, two monks Xianlin and Daji from Yinxiu Temple in Mt. Putuo of the South Sea sailed with a statue of Guanyin. A storm hit them and the ship was drifted to the pier of Taipei (area around Taipei Bridge). The two monks met Li You from Dinzhuwei of Luzhou. When Li You saw the statute of Guanyin, he prayed piously to the Buddha that if his business was good on that day, he would return to thank the Buddha. When LI You worshiped Guanyin with incenses in hand, the incenses in the burner suddenly burned. After asking for the God's intentions, they realized that Guanyin would like to stay in Louzicuo Luzhou. They then built a thatched cottage as the temple.

The power of Buddha was so majestic that there were more and more believers and the cottage was not big enough to accommodate them all. In the 11th year of Tongzhi Emperor (1872) in Qing Dynasty, a new temple was built and it was named "Yonglian Temple" because it is located in the land of lotus lair.

It faces north by northwest, roughly opposite from Guanyin Mountain. It is a 4-seciton compound with three entrances and three back constructions. Now only 7 halls, 56 rooms, 82 doors and 120 windows are kept. There is a lotus pond in the front and a Huatai in the back (the sun shines in front of the Residence with a backing, which means the Residence has good fengshui). Both of sides are built in half circle shape like hand railings of a fauteuil, and its foundation is a square (round on the outside and square on the inside). The roof is the most beautiful one among existing 4-seciton compounds in Taiwan. It is suffice to say that this residence is a land of culture Shangrila.
